Transaction 520e28f25ea506e2ce807ff9884470504f75dc324af4db280574888390a8da20
1 Input
2 Outputs
- 520e28f25ea506e2ce807ff9884470504f75dc324af4db280574888390a8da20:0
- 520e28f25ea506e2ce807ff9884470504f75dc324af4db280574888390a8da20:1
value 343265
address 3LcRDCWsTiaSqKHMnySxzLfcUhzQJDzA3t
value 39294824
address 351kqTaiC8vPzgww7aUWLvx7wDcG2BKVLd